&lt;div&gt;===The idea.===&lt;br /&gt;
[[Image:Rockit-logo.jpg|right|thumb|250px|Captain Rock&#039;it and the Sound of Stars]]&lt;br /&gt;
[[Image:Rockit-fly.jpg|right|thumb|250px|Fly through the space]]&lt;br /&gt;
Imagine the universe&#039;s infinite emptiness, a place where absolute silence rules. We want to fill this space symbolical and give the innumerably stars a special sound. In interaction between the user and stars and the stars among themselves, different sounds will be created. They will picture a musical portrait of the universe.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
===The concept.===&lt;br /&gt;
The user flies with a starship through the space. He is able to interact with the stars by shooting at them. An activated star makes a noise and a shockwave arises. It evolves through the space and activates other stars and items on its way. These also make sounds and send new shockwaves. A chain reaction starts and an unique world of sounds evolves.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
===The editorially arrangement.===&lt;br /&gt;
The tone color and volume of the created sound depend on the size of stars. A large star creates a deep and loud tone.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
===Life and death.===&lt;br /&gt;
The shockwave which is sent out by a star has a finite lifetime. With growing size it gets weaker. How large a shockwave can become is related to the size of the star.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
===The realization.===&lt;br /&gt;
The interface for our project is built with Flash. All sounds will be integrated into the Flash file, so the game is very portable and easy to handle. The application is also playable online because no special hard- or software is needed.&lt;br /&gt;

==[[Andreas Beyer]]: The Radiostar==&lt;br /&gt;
Since more than 100 years humankind uses technology for broardcasting content and for some physics reasons nearly 80% of that signals are just &amp;quot;lost&amp;quot; in space. That means the nearby outer space ( 100 ly orbit) is in a way a kind of radioarchive or a cultural documentation of hunmankinds ability to send signals with several technologies. I&#039;m focused on the frequency band of ultra short wave radio signals. To explain this cosmic-international radioarchive, I want to create a navigationplan to &amp;quot;travel&amp;quot; through that archive. the installation will be a (selfmade) telescopebody (no tech inside) that can be moved in different directions to zoom into a model of that &amp;quot;radiohalo&amp;quot;. The room, where the telescope will be placed, is prepaired with some small radiotransmitters (selfmade) to symbolize where some particularly broadcasts are “waving” in outer space. Inside that telescopebody will be some, i think maybe three, radioreceivers to get in contact with the transmitters and by moving that telescopebody the recipient can adjust the programm that sounds in the body of the telescope (sorry for my bad english).&lt;br /&gt;

==[[Jamie Ferguson]]: [[/Vanessa_Cardui in Space|Vanessa_Cardui in Space]]==&lt;br /&gt;
[[Image:Iso_ftpc.jpg|right|thumb|250px|isometric view]]&lt;br /&gt;
This project began by following the &#039;Butterflies In Space&#039; project sponsored by the National Space Biomedical Research Institute; Vanessa Cardui larvae that hatched six days earlier flew aboard Space Shuttle Atlantis to the International Space Station. Children from American elementary schools were encouraged to take part by creating their own butterfly habitats in the class room, to watch the butterflies live and grow and die over the course of 25 days; the greatest variable being gravity. The second was possibly the &#039;payload&#039;, the artificial habitat taken aboard to house the larvae. The difference is not so much in its content but with the container itself. A &#039;flight certified scientific insert&#039; was developed at BioServe Space Technologies at the University of Colorado. &amp;quot;Our…competency is enabling the conduct of space life sciences research in a highly regulated environment in such a way as to make the complicated process completely transparent to the investigator.&amp;quot; This appeared a very different object from the terrariums and disposable plastic food containers the school children were promoted to use, but their aims were comparable.   &lt;br /&gt;

==[[Stefan Bernhardt]] and [[Christoph Schreiber]]==&lt;br /&gt;
===Creating a self-playing instrument===&lt;br /&gt;
We want to create a self-playing instrument that uses a map of stars for creating soundscapes. The user should be able to change the snippet of the map, draw and edit zodiac signs and start and stop sounds.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
When a star is clicked, it makes a noise and a shockwave comes up. It evolves through the space and activates other stars and items on its way which also make sounds and send new shockwaves. So the application doesn&#039;t need any user input to go on but the user can take influence on the continuity.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
If a zodiac sign gets activated all linked stars will start making tones at the same time.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
====Two methods: Samples or MIDI====&lt;br /&gt;
At the moment there are two techniques for realizing this idea:&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
# We render samples of the instruments and embed them in our application. It&#039;s easier to develop but very limited in functionality. The application could be distributed via web because no special hard- or software is needed.&lt;br /&gt;
# We send MIDI events to an external software synthesizer which will create the sounds. This requires a powerful machine and much research but is more powerful in the aspect of flexibility and creativity. The application needs some additional software to be running in the background so it won&#039;t be capable to be distributed as out-of-the-box experience.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
====Have some fun with Flash and MIDI====&lt;br /&gt;
Finally we finished our research in sending MIDI signals from Flash to other apps. To do so, we developed a little proxy app which sends MIDI signals. At first, Flash sends commands via a networking interface to the proxy app which acts as a server. Afterwards, the proxy app converts this data to MIDI signals which will be passes to a virtual MIDI interface. This interface is connected to our synthesizer. This allows us to control any MIDI-enabled app just as good as you would do it with controller hardware.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
For testing purposes we coded a little framework which consists of some small classes and some GUI elements like buttons, sliders and a two-axis-panning field.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
[[File:StarSynth-MIDI-GUI.gif]]&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
=====Current problems=====&lt;br /&gt;
# The whole synthesizer stuff is very very CPU intensive. So we have to optimize it or use a better machine (which is also difficult because of the software licenses).&lt;br /&gt;
# Sometimes there are big latencies when transfering the controller data from Flash to the synthesizer. Maybe it is also related to the CPU usage of the softsynths. We have to investigate this issue.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
=====New possibility=====&lt;br /&gt;
# Because of the networking interface, it is also possible to use multiple computers to control the synths. So the interface can be run through another machine which is also better for performance reasons.&lt;br /&gt;

==[[Katarina Sengstaken]], [[Timea Tofalvi]], [[Yuxiang Wen]], and [[Shuo Liu]]: A Faraway Cold Palace (广寒宫)==&lt;br /&gt;
===Installation Concept===&lt;br /&gt;
A faraway Cold Palace is a room installation featuring sound, lights, leaves, and dust to abstractly simulate the feeling of being on the moon.  Our concept of the moon stems from the three Chinese moon myths the story of [http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Chang%27e/ Chang&#039;e] 嫦娥, [http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Wu_Gang/ Wu Gang]吴刚 , and the [http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Moon_rabbit/ Jade Rabbit] 玉兔. These three myths revolve around a mystical laurel tree that grows on the moon.  &lt;br /&gt;
We will use sound to represent the myths, the sound of an axe chopping at the tree to illustrate the story of Wu Gang, a fan flapping for the story of Chang’e, and the sound of a mortar grinding as representation of the Jade rabbit story.  As for the tree it’s represented by white bay leaves tied to translucent string attached to mechanical pulleys in the ceiling that will slowly raise and drop the leaves. &lt;br /&gt;
The room is lit by black lights that run along the base of the walls. The floor is covered with gray dust spotted with craters with constructed dust free walkways, to give the impression of the moons surface. &l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Our project comes from the recent discovery and search for water on the moon.  That raised the question for us, on what life on the moon would be like, and what alien lifeforms would be like.  Which brought us to discussing mythology, especially Chinese myths about the moon, and so is our pieces inspiration.&lt;br /&gt;
